At the beginning of the reign of King Jehoiakim son of Josiah of Judah, this word came from the Lord:
2
Thus says the Lord: Stand in the court of the Lord's house, and speak to all the cities of Judah that come to worship in the house of the Lord; speak to them all the words that I command you; do not hold back a word.
3
It may be that they will listen, all of them, and will turn from their evil way, that I may change my mind about the disaster that I intend to bring on them because of their evil doings.
4
You shall say to them: Thus says the Lord: If you will not listen to me, to walk in my law that I have set before you,
5
and to heed the words of my servants the prophets whom I send to you urgently—though you have not heeded—
6
then I will make this house like Shiloh, and I will make this city a curse for all the nations of the earth.
